New exact solutions of the three-dimensional sine-Gordon (SG) equation are obtained. These solutions depend on arbitrary function \(F(\alpha)\), which argument is some function \(\alpha(x, y, z, t)\). The ansatz \(\alpha\) is found from the linear equation with respect to \(x, y, z, t,\) whose coefficients are arbitrary functions depending on \(\alpha\). These coefficients must satisfy a system of algebraic equations. By this method, the classical and generalized SG-equations with first derivatives with respect to \(x, y, z, t\) are solved. The SG-equation with only first time derivative is considered separately. Approaches for solutions of SG-equation with variable amplitude are proposed. These methods admit natural generalization in case of integration of the above mentioned types of equations in a space with any number of dimensions.
